Job Title: Head of School

Location: Lagos

Job Description

  • The successful candidate will work closely under the direction of the Executive Director and will have a part-time teaching commitment.
  • The person appointed is expected to approach this post in the light of the statement of the vision of Silverwood School Maryland.
  •  The Head of School will be expected to maintain and develop an atmosphere and structures where all children and adults are valued and enables them to fulfill the school’s high expectations.

Curriculum:

  • To be responsible for maintaining and developing a broad, balanced and cohesive curriculum suitable for all of the children and meeting national guidelines.
  • To ensure that the curriculum is regularly reviewed, evaluated and applied.
  • To ensure that the assessment requirements of the curriculum are appropriately carried out.

Children:

  • To ensure that children receive high quality education designed to promote excitement, enjoyment and enthusiasm in learning, leading to the pursuit of excellence.
  • To ensure equality of opportunity for all, through the school’s policies, procedures and practices.
  • To ensure that the progress of each child is monitored and recorded so that the most appropriate decisions can be taken with regard to the next step in his/her education.
  • To ensure that the activities in which children are engaged are conducted in a caring, disciplined, safe and healthy environment.
  • To ensure all children are valued as individuals and ensure that all children are confident and able to achieve their full potential.
  • To maintain a school environment in which the needs and value of individual children are recognised and which also contribute positively towards their spiritual, social, cultural and moral development.

Leadership:

  • To share the strategic vision of the school and assist the Executive Director in the translation and execution of this vision at Silverwood School
  • Responsible, with the Executive Director, for the appointment of teaching and non-teaching staff and all related personnel issues.
  • To ensure levels of performance necessary to achieve the agreed aims and objectives of Silverwood School Maryland.
  • To lead, motivate, encourage, support, monitor and evaluate to ensure continuing school improvement.
  • To ensure that all staff have access to regular advice and have a training and development plan in place appropriate to the needs of the school and to their stage of development.
  • To be responsible for the annual performance management cycle for all teachers and to report to the Governing Body on the professional development of all teachers in the school.
  • To ensure all staff are valued as individuals and receive courtesy and respect at all times.

Safeguarding:

  • To ensure that safeguarding is of paramount importance in our school.
  • To ensure the commitment of the Governing Body to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people is at the heart of the school and to ensure that all staff and volunteers share this commitment.
